재판 학습 : https://www.cnblogs.com/alex3714/articles/8359404.html
A는 도서관 소개를 요청
요청은 아파치 오픈 소스 라이브러리를 라이센스 HTTP 프로토콜을 사용하여 작성된 파이썬 언어를 기반으로 URLLIB를 사용하고 있습니다.
두, 기본 라이브러리 사용을 요청
가져 오기 요청 응답 = requests.get ( " https://www.baidu.com " ) 인쇄 (response.status_code) 인쇄 (response.text) 인쇄 (에는 Response.Cookies) 인쇄 (response.content를)
직접 response.text가 깨진 경우 다음과 같이 많은 경우에 사이트가 문제가 될 것입니다, 자주 사용되는 솔루션입니다 :
가져 오기 요청 응답 = requests.get ( " https://www.baidu.com " )
:方法(1) 인쇄 (response.content.decode ( " UTF-8 " )) # 方法2 : response.encoding을 = " UTF-8 " 인쇄 (response.text)
세, 요청 요청
수입 요청 (requests.post " http://httpbin.org/post " ) requests.put ( " http://httpbin.org/put " ) requests.delete를 ( " http://httpbin.org/delete " ) requests.head ( " http://httpbin.org/get " ) requests.options ( " http://httpbin.org/get " )